Summary:

This role would be to complete all filter changes, and PM maintenance on all Production equipment, including filter changes, crane inspections, lubing and repairing planned items to eliminate stoppages while Production is in motion.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

· Filter changes, crane inspections, lubing.

· Planned repairs.

· Provides support to plant and production if breakdown of equipment occurs; and is available 24/7 to work through complex and maintenance related issues.

· Complete scheduled work assignments, under the direction of the Maintenance Supervisor, Maintenance Lead and Maintenance Director.

· Responsible for preparation, installation and repair of equipment as necessary. Track, analyze and take corrective action to prevent equipment down time.

· Assist in planning, organizing, implementing and monitoring the installation of assigned capital/improvement projects.
